Frequently asked questions about Healdton Es
How many students attend Healdton Es?
Healdton Es has 237 students enrolled. It is a public school in Healdton, OK. CCD year-over-year: 209 (2022-23) → 237 (2023-24), up 28.
What is the student-teacher ratio at Healdton Es?
The student-teacher ratio at Healdton Es is 19.8:1, which is 23% higher than the Oklahoma average of 16.1:1 and 26% higher than the national average of 15.7:1.
What is the racial and ethnic makeup of Healdton Es?
The largest demographic group at Healdton Es is White at 65.0% of enrollment, in Healdton, OK. Its student body is more racially and ethnically mixed than most US schools, with a diversity index of 53.5/100.
What is the Resource Investment Index for Healdton Es?
Healdton Es has a Resource Investment Index of 45/100 (typical reported resources relative to schools nationally) based on 4 factors: student-teacher ratio, gifted-program reporting, counselor availability, chronic absenteeism.
